FAQ

Is AIQ always more prestigious than state quota?

Not necessarily — it includes AIIMS/JIPMER and central colleges, but many state government medical colleges are equally well-regarded within their state and nationally. Prestige varies by individual institution, not by which quota it's allotted through.

Can I get an AIQ seat and a state seat at the same time?

You can be allotted a seat in both processes simultaneously since they run independently, but you can only join one college — accepting one typically requires you to withdraw from further rounds of the other, so check both processes' exit rules before deciding.

Does my state quota rank differ from my AIQ/All-India rank?

Your NEET All-India Rank (AIR) is the same number everywhere, but a few states compute and publish their own separate state merit rank for their own counselling — always check whether your state uses AIR or a state-specific rank.
